philosophy
Title: Combat Philosophy
Content:
Combat should be tactical and descriptive.
Battles are dangerous. The outcome depends on preparation, equipment, teamwork, knowledge, and decisions.
The AI should not force victories or defeats. Players can succeed through creativity, strategy, or using their environment.
Injuries, exhaustion, limited resources, and mistakes should matter.
expedition
Title: Expedition System
Content:
Adventurers are specialists rather than traditional RPG classes.
Every adventurer has a Specialty: a skill that makes them valuable to an expedition.
Examples:
Recovery specialists heal injuries and cure illnesses.
Cooks prepare monster ingredients into useful meals.
Lockpickers bypass traps and ancient mechanisms.
Monster experts identify creatures and weaknesses.
Cartographers map unknown areas.
Blacksmiths repair and improve equipment.
A successful party depends on cooperation between different specialties.
the living dungeon
Title: The Living Dungeon
Content:
The Great Dungeon is not a collection of random rooms. It is a living environment with its own ecosystems.
Creatures have habitats, diets, behaviors, territories, and relationships with other creatures. Monsters are not simply enemies; they are living beings that may hunt, flee, communicate, cooperate, or adapt.
Different dungeon floors have unique climates, resources, dangers, and cultures.
The dungeon changes based on the actions of adventurers.
